What is HIV?
This is a virus which attacks the body’s defence system (immune system), and makes you less able to fight off infections. You may have HIV for many years and feel quite well. When the immune system begins to break down, infections and cancers can develop, known as AIDS.
How to keep safe
You cannot tell by looking at someone if they have this virus, so always
use a condom for vaginal, anal and oral sex.
Never share any drug equipment.
Needle exchanges are available throughout the region.
Never share personal items such as razors, or tooth brushes.
